One of the few bright spots of the day,
Interdigital Communications
(
IDCC |
Quote |
Chart |
News |
PowerRating), jumped 26% on over ten times its average volume. The company
announced that they entered into a licensing agreement with NEC Corp.
(
NIPNY |
Quote |
Chart |
News |
PowerRating)
for the sale of its third-generation wireless products. Interdigital will
receive royalties on every unit sold by NEC. Interdigital will also be receiving
an advanced royalty payment of $19.5 million. Its implied volatility is
high, thereby
making its options expensive.
Semiconductor maker Teradyne
(
TER |
Quote |
Chart |
News |
PowerRating) dropped
14% on
over double its average
volume. The shares have now fallen below its 50-day moving average and its .382
retracement level from its October lows. The company disappointed Wall Street as
they posted a loss of $ 0.63 per share vs. the expected loss of $ 0.43 per
share. Its options traded over four times its average volume. There is heavy put
activity.
Shares of Fluor
(
FLR |
Quote |
Chart |
News |
PowerRating) fell 13% on over four times its average
volume and continued to break down from a descending triangle.
The company slumped on the news that Calpine
(
CPN |
Quote |
Chart |
News |
PowerRating) would end its plans to
build new power plants and cut capital spending. There is heavy activity in the
February 12.50 and 15 puts.
